Local models for vulnerability assessment

Security teams can leverage local LLMs to enhance vulnerability scanning and code review processes. A local model can examine source code to identify known vulnerability patterns—such as injection flaws, unsafe deserialization, and hardcoded secrets—and highlight suspicious logic. Additionally, it can assist in developing and reviewing exploit proof-of-concepts during authorized engagements.

Certain security tasks may encounter content policy restrictions when using commercial APIs. Tasks like generating exploit PoCs, analyzing malware strings, or drafting red-team prompts are often blocked by the safety layers of frontier models. Local models, free from these specific restrictions, can handle these requirements, which is why many security teams prefer running their own models for this type of work.
